No doubt. In 13 years of bowhunting I have over 50 kills in four different states, and almost half of them are from the ground. The gus in my family give me grief, but I kill deer every year from the ground. Like my new ladder stands as wee, but it can be done with the right setup.

Dont like heights myself, I have 5 ladder styands, and the highest one is only about 11'. I know it would be better to be higher, but I have been hunting 4 years, and have 3 bow kills to my name, so it can be done. And I have passed on many deer that had no idea that I was there. Just make sure that you have lots of back cover. NO point in going any higher, if you wont be able to move when you see a deer becouse you are scared crapless.[&:]
